Real Estate Co-Op / Condo Attorney - New York
Our client, a full-service law firm, is seeking a motivated and detail-oriented attorney to join their dynamic real estate team in New York City.
The estimated salary range for this position is $220,000 - $295,000 (annually) and may vary depending on experience and other factors.
Qualifications :
- Experience in Co-op and Condominium law
- Strong research, writing, and communication skills
- JD from an accredited law school and excellent academic credentials
- Admitted to the New York State Bar
Key Responsibilities :
Advise co-op and condominium boards on governance issues, fiduciary duties, and compliance with governing documents and applicable laws.Draft and negotiate construction, vendor, and professional service contracts.Assist with the refinancing of underlying mortgages and lines of credit transactions.Review, revise, and amend governing documents, including proprietary leases, bylaws, condominium declarations, and house rules.Counsel clients on the preparation and conduct of annual and special shareholder / unit owner meetings, including election procedures and proxy matters.Conduct annual and special meetings, including oversight of voting and reporting procedures.Provide guidance on regulatory and compliance issues, including those related to the Business Corporation Law (BCL) and Condominium Act.Assist in the review and negotiation of retail and commercial leases within co-op and condo buildings.Handle cooperative and condominium closings and advise on related transactional matters.Advise on trust transfers and review associated documentation.Work collaboratively with partners and clients to ensure timely and accurate delivery of legal services.About Us
